Transaction 38423f370031f859491ceb480b161164aa4a433ceb04bc21ecf484fdf3f4759e
1 Input
1 Output
-
38423f370031f859491ceb480b161164aa4a433ceb04bc21ecf484fdf3f4759e:0
- value
- 2069215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8139a92063973e9799d1d45e478b7f5955da475e OP_EQUAL
- address
- 3DUJAd32RJdYbM3XvoU7FcFjMRHpozYmJ9